On Tue, Apr 06, 1999 at 01:21:17AM -0400, [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ote:
 i used netcfg and setup everything the same time
 
 it connects but doesnt work
 
 and iv checked, double checked, and triple checked the DNS servers and domain 
 name  

Are there errors in /var/log/messages?  Have you enabled the debug mode to
see where the errors are occurring?  Are the username and password correct? 
Have you verified that the login sequence is correct?  Have you tried using
the Internet as root?  What happens?  What happens as a normal user?  Do IP 
addresses work? do textual names work?
